Unleashed versatility defines the Work Sharp MK2, a powerhouse that transcends typical knife sharpeners by doubling as a full multi-tool sharpening system. With its flexible abrasive belts and two-speed motor (1,200/2,400 RPM), it handles everything from pocket knives to lawnmower blades with surgical precision. The adjustable angle guide lets you customize bevels from 15° to 25°, making it a dream for enthusiasts who demand control—whether reviving a chipped cleaver or tuning a hunting blade. It solves the universal frustration of owning multiple tools for different edges by consolidating them into one benchtop sharpening station.

In real-world testing, the MK2 excels when tackling heavy-duty grinding tasks, where most electric sharpeners tap out. The coarse belt quickly removes metal to reshape damaged edges, while the fine belt polishes to a refined finish. Its belt system conforms perfectly to curved or serrated blades, outperforming fixed-wheel models on outdoor gear and garden tools. However, the learning curve is steeper than pull-through sharpeners, and it demands more setup time—this isn’t a grab-and-go device. Still, for users with diverse sharpening needs, its consistent edge reproducibility across tools is unmatched.

Compared to the Presto EverSharp or Secura models, the MK2 isn’t meant for quick kitchen touch-ups—it’s engineered for serious sharpeners and DIYers who value adaptability over simplicity. While it lacks built-in dust collection, its Oregon-built durability and 3-year warranty signal long-term reliability. It doesn’t compete on speed with budget units, but it dominates in scope: where others sharpen knives, the MK2 sharpens knives, tools, and yard equipment alike—making it a performance leader for those who measure value in versatility.

The Chef’sChoice 15XV is the undisputed king of edge refinement, combining 100% diamond abrasives with a patented flexible polishing system to deliver the Trizor XV 15° edge—a razor-sharp, long-lasting finish that outperforms nearly every other electric sharpener on the market. In just 10 seconds of resharpening, it restores blades to surgical sharpness, solving the need for frequent, low-effort maintenance without sacrificing edge quality. Its automatic spring-guided system adjusts to your knife’s angle, eliminating user error and ensuring perfect contact every time—ideal for both pros and perfectionists.

Testing confirms its elite status: Stage 1 and 2 rapidly sharpen with diamond abrasives, while Stage 3’s flexible stropping wheel polishes serrated knives without damaging the teeth—a feat few sharpeners achieve. It handles both straight and serrated blades with equal finesse, and the results last weeks longer than sharpeners using basic wheels. The compact design fits easily on countertops, though the motor can hum noticeably during use. It’s not the cheapest, and it’s overkill for occasional users, but for those who demand the sharpest possible edge, it’s unmatched.

Against the Narcissus S867 or DSkiley 3-stage model, the 15XV justifies its premium with faster, finer, and longer-lasting results—especially on high-end Japanese and serrated knives. It’s best for serious home chefs and culinary professionals who treat their knives like tools of the trade. While others sharpen, the 15XV redefines what sharp means, offering a level of precision and durability that sets the industry standard.

Choosing the Right Electric Knife Sharpener

Electric knife sharpeners offer a convenient and consistent way to maintain sharp kitchen blades. However, with numerous options available, selecting the best one for your needs requires careful consideration. Here’s a breakdown of key features to help you make an informed decision.

Sharpening Stages & Abrasive Material

The number of sharpening stages and the abrasive material used are critical factors. Most electric sharpeners utilize a multi-stage system – typically two or three. A two-stage sharpener generally focuses on sharpening and polishing, suitable for knives that aren’t severely dull. A three-stage sharpener adds a preliminary stage for repairing damaged edges, making it ideal for very dull or damaged blades.

The abrasive material is equally important. Diamond abrasives are the hardest and most effective, quickly removing metal to create a sharp edge. They are ideal for all knife types, including harder steel. Ceramic abrasives are gentler and better for honing and polishing, often found in the final stage. Sharpeners using diamond abrasives generally deliver faster and more durable sharpening results.

Angle Guides & Knife Compatibility

Maintaining the correct angle is crucial for a sharp, long-lasting edge. Most electric sharpeners feature preset angle guides, typically around 15 or 20 degrees. A 15-degree angle creates a sharper edge but is more delicate, while a 20-degree angle is more durable.

Consider the types of knives you own. Some sharpeners are specifically designed for certain blade types – for example, some excel at sharpening serrated knives, while others are limited to straight-edged blades. Ensure the sharpener you choose is compatible with your knife collection. Some models, like the Work Sharp MK2, are more versatile and can handle a wider range of tools.

Motor Power & Stability

The motor power influences the sharpening speed and ability to handle harder steels. A more powerful motor will make quicker work of dull knives and is essential for sharpening thicker blades or outdoor tools.

Stability is also vital. Look for sharpeners with non-slip feet to prevent movement during operation. A stable base reduces vibration and ensures consistent sharpening. Features like those found in the Narcissus S867, with a lower center of gravity and anti-slip pads, contribute to a safer and more effective sharpening experience.
